JLS 'to launch US offensive in spring'
Published Friday, Feb 19 2010, 11:56 GMT | By David Balls

Rex Features
The group, who are currently on their UK theatre tour, will fly out to start promotion once they complete the jaunt next month.
The group recently secured a US recording contract with Jive Records and are expected to release 'Everybody In Love' as their first single.
According to The Sun, the four-piece have been warned that they will have to work hard to succeed in the US market.
"Few British bands have made it over there, so management have told them not to expect overnight success," a source said.
Rapper Jay-Z, who saw the group perform at the Brit Awards earlier this week, insisted that they could be as popular as 'N Sync.
